HAM AND CHEESE PIZZA



Ham and Cheese Pizza image

When a classic sandwich gets reincarnated as a cheesy pizza, rave reviews are bound to follow. Sweet, crisp Fuji apple provides a great balance to the rich, gooey cheese and savory ham, and everyone knows there's no better place to slip in some extra leafy greens than on a pizza. To get julienne-cut apple pieces, cut into thin slices; then stack and cut lengthwise into matchsticks. Break out this recipe to transform your traditional pizza night, or use it as an excuse to skip delivery this week. The pizza comes together in less than 25 minutes, cooking in only nine, so grab the ingredients and keep them on hand for when you need a delicious dinner fast!

Provided by Adam Hickman

Yield Serves 4 (serving size: 2 wedges)

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 tablespoon olive oil, divided
4 ounces fresh baby spinach
1 (8-oz.) prebaked thin pizza crust (such as Mama Mary's)
1/4 cup lower-sodium marinara sauce (such as Rao's)
4 ounces lower-sodium deli ham, diced
2 ounces shredded reduced-fat cheddar cheese (about 1/2 cup)
2 ounces fresh mozzarella cheese, torn
1/2 cup julienne-cut Fuji apple
1/4 teaspoon black pepper
1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 500°F.
  • Heat 1 teaspoon oil in a large skillet over medium-high. Add spinach; cook 3 minutes or until completely wilted, stirring frequently. Remove from heat.
  • Place pizza crust on a sheet of parchment paper; spread marinara sauce evenly over crust. Arrange spinach, ham, cheddar, and mozzarella evenly over sauce. Place pizza on parchment directly on oven rack; bake at 500°F for 9 minutes or until cheese melts and begins to brown. Remove from oven. Top with apple and peppers; drizzle with remaining 2 teaspoons oil. Cut into 8 wedges.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 353, Carbohydrate 38 g, Cholesterol 34 mg, Fat 15.6 g, Fiber 4 g, Protein 16 g, SaturatedFat 5 g, Sodium 618 mg, Sugar 6 g

LEFTOVER HAM AND CHEESE PIZZA



Leftover Ham and Cheese Pizza image

This leftover ham pizza can be made using store-bought ingredients, but just remember to adjust cooking time accordingly to your dough's instructions!

Provided by Rosie

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 cups leftover ham (chopped)
1 batch pizza dough ((store bought or homemade))
cup pizza sauce ((store bought or homemade))
8 ounces fresh mozzarella (sliced)
1 large onion (sliced)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 475F. Lightly dust your counter-top in flour.
  • Using a rolling pin, roll out your pizza dough until desired size and thickness is reached. Carefully transfer to pizza pan and adjust accordingly.
  • Spread your sauce to about 1-inch from the edge of the pizza dough. That uncovered part will be your crust. Evenly spread out the ham and onion. Finish off with mozzarella cheese.
  • Place into oven and bake for 15-17 minutes, or until mozzarella cheese is nicely browned and crust is golden.
  • Allow to cool slightly before cutting!

HAM AND CHEESE PITA PIZZA



Ham and Cheese Pita Pizza image

This makes a nice, easy lunchtime snack for the kids or a light dinner with a green salad when you don't feel like cooking. You may use whatever type of cheese you like or have on hand, so it's very versatile.

Provided by Irmgard

Categories     Lunch/Snacks

Time 25m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 pita breads
1/2 cup tomato sauce (2 tbsp. for each pita)
4 slices black forest ham, chopped
1 1/2 cups mozzarella cheese, shredded
4 tablespoons parmesan cheese, grated
salt
ground black pepper
1 pinch dried oregano (optional)
olive oil

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F.
  •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per for quick clean up.
  • Place the pita breads onto the baking sheet.
  • Spread the tomato sauce evenly over the pitas.
  • Top evenly with ham and the two cheeses.
  • Season the pizza with salt, pepper and the oregano, if using.
  • Drizzle with a little olive oil.
  • Bake until the cheese is golden and bubbly, about 10 to 15 minutes.
  • Cut into quarters and ser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 368, Fat 14, SaturatedFat 7.3, Cholesterol 53.5, Sodium 1187, Carbohydrate 37.9, Fiber 2.1, Sugar 2.6, Protein 21.8

HAM, CHEESE, AND TOMATO PIZZA



Ham, Cheese, and Tomato Pizza image

Make and share this Ham, Cheese, and Tomato Pizza rec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Sara 76

Categories     Ham

Time 30m

Yield 1 pizza

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 pizza crust
2 tablespoons pizza sauce
1/2 cup ham, chopped
1 tablespoon onion, chopped
6 cherry tomatoes, quartered
1 tablespoon basil
1/4 cup parmesan cheese, shredded
1/4 cup mozzarella cheese, shredded
1/4 cup tasty cheese, shredded

Steps:

  • Spread the sauce over the pizza crust.
  • Combine cheeses in a small bowl, and scatter a little over the sauce.
  • Scatter the ham and onion over the pizza, then arrange the tomato.
  • Sprinkle with basil, and top with remaining cheese.
  • Bake at 180C for 20 minutes or until cheese is melted and bubbly, and base is cooked.
